| BinaryConvert | |
| BinaryReaderExtensions | |
| BinaryWriterExtensions | |
| ConvertibleExtensions | Provides extension methods for IConvertible. |
| DefaultProviderTProvider, T | |
| DynamicInvoke | Provides static methods for invoking operators using reflection. |
| FuncExtensions | |
| RandomExtensions | |
| StringUtilities |
| IBinaryIOT | Provides support for reading and writing types in binary using BinaryReader and BinaryWriter. |
| IProviderT | Provides a mechanism for retrieving an instance of a type. |
| IVariantRandomT | Provides support for pseudo-random generation of variants of a type using Random. |
| Variants | Specifies categories for the random generation of objects. The exact definition of each category is left to the implementor. |